CommonSpirit Health is Hiring a Physical Therapist Near Lufkin, TX

  • Overview* St. Luke’s Health-Memorial paves the way for quality innovative health care in East Texas and provides more than a quarter of a million patient services each year. With hospitals in Lufkin Livingston and San Augustine St. Luke’s Health-Memorial provides millions of dollars in charity care and community support each year.
CommonSpirit Health was formed by the alignment of Catholic Health Initiatives (CHI) and Dignity Health. With more than 700 care sites across the U.S. & from clinics and hospitals to home-based care and virtual care services CommonSpirit is accessible to nearly one out of every four U.S. residents.   • Responsibilities* Provides physical therapy services in development, implementation, and coordination of the physical therapy program; screens, evaluates, provides therapeutic intervention for individuals identified with disabilities that interfere with their ability to perform daily life activities; must possess professional judgment and clinical knowledge to develop individualized programs. Exercises independent judgment and decision making within the limitations and scope of practice. Displays professional, safe conduct in all interactions. Maintains positive working relationships with staff, other departments, physicians and peers. Displays conduct in support of CHI St. Luke’s Health Memorial Mission & Vision.
  • Evaluates, plans and implements physical therapy treatment programs according to physician referral, and/or plan of care. Designs programs to meet the patient’s physical, psychological, and age specific needs; Performs evaluations, tests, and measurements of functional status, neuromuscular, musculoskeletal, cognitive/perceptual, and sensory /psychological functions.
  • Works collaboratively with all members of the interdisciplinary team, other departments and disciplines to assure patients and customer’s needs are met in a timely manner; encourages the active participation of the patient and/or family in goal setting and patient/family training/education.
  • Completes all necessary documentation as outlined by departmental policy and documentation review. This includes, but is not limited to patient care charting, charge entry, completing peer chart and peer reviews, and documenting on daily schedule.
  • Coordinates care of patients with other departmental and hospital activities in a manner that fosters a positive professional image consistent with the departmental and hospital goals and mission statement. This includes, but is not limited to, discharge planning, participation in care conferences, interdisciplinary rounds, collaborative practice groups, the student program and community endeavors.
  • Assigns, supervises and reviews the care of patients and duties of the Physical Therapist Assistant and therapy aide.

  • Qualifications*
  • Education Level*
  • Required:
  • Bachelor's Degree - Physical Therapy
  • Preferred:*
Advanced degree (Master’s degree or Doctorate degree) in Physical Therapy or related field.
  • Licensure/Certification*
  • Required:
  • Current Texas State Licensure (PT) (PTOT)- issued by Executive Council of Physical Therapy and Occupational Therapy Examiners-(ECPTOTE) BLS certification (through an approved AHA program).
  • Preferred:
  • Member of the American Physical Therapy Association (APTA) and the Texas Physical Therapy Association (TPTA).
  •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ities* Must be able to effectively use computer and computer programs for documentation, departmental information and inter/intra departmental communication.
  • Experience*
  • Required:* None
  • Preferred:* 2-3 years of professional experience as Physical Therapist
  • Disclosure Statement:* The above statements reflect the general details considered necessary to describe the essential functions of the job as identified, and shall not be considered a detailed description of all work requirements that may be inherent in position.
  • Pay Range* $36.87 - $53.46 /hour
